What they do

A Customer Service Representative interacts directly with customers to answer questions and solve problems. Communicates with customers in person, over the phone or online. Provides help with troubleshooting technical problems for equipment or software. Keeps records of customer communications and transactions.

Job Description

We are looking for an outgoing and enthusiastic Customer Service Representative. As a Customer Service Representative, you will perform clerical duties. More specifically, you will: Answer incoming phone calls. Assist in coordinating travel and trade shows. Provide administrative support. Serve as support for sales and marketing. Entering phone and will call orders. Call on existing and potential customers. Ensure customer satisfaction. Support the overall business success and needs of our customers.
The ideal candidate will:
Cheerfully and enthusiastically care for customers' needs. Accept responsibility and account for actions. Communicate professionally. Pay attention to details. Take initiative and complete assignments with little supervision. Be organized and follow policies and systematic method of performing tasks. To apply for this position, you must have high school diploma (or GED), and be proficient in Microsoft Word and Excel. Key benefits include 401(k) retirement plan with generous company match, excellent health, dental & vision care plan options, flexible spending account and health savings account options, life & disability insurance, paid vacation, and 8 paid company holidays. The candidate will be compensated based on their work experiences and skills, with the minimum starting salary for this position being $18.00 per hour.
